Job Description

District Office

1.0 FTE Continuing Contract

DESCRIPTION: The function of this position is to oversee theMultilingual Education Program within the Wenatchee School District under the direct supervision of the Director of State & Federal Programs. This individual will work alongside allMultilingual Education staff across the District to provide training support and ensure successful implementation ofMultilingual Education Programgoals and objectives.

RESPONSIBILITIES:All responsibilities are focusedacross the District and include but are not limited to the following priorities:Conduct/facilitate a local needs assessment that identifies the needs ofmultilingual students identified within the boundaries of the Wenatchee School and oversee a DistrictMultilingual with OSPI grants related toMultilingual the activities ofMultilingual Educatorstaff to ensure services are completed in accordance with State & Federal all ELD Education staff training is current and and/or lead staff or community trainingsrelated toMultilingual the implementation of the annaul K12 WIDA English language proficiency assessment in coordination the District Assessment Coordinator and other assigned Special Program support staff. Assist with endofyear evaluation and related data collection and to perform work or supervisory duties outside of the regular school duties as assigned.

QUALIFICATIONS: At least 5 years successful teaching experience.Experience in administrating school or district level programs/activities.Valid Washington State Teacher Certification. ELL endorseement required. Bilingual/Biliterate in Spanish required.Knowledge ofWA SateMultilingual Education of WIDA Language Standards and Assessment.Experience in working with or amongMultilingual families and students.Experience and background in teaching adult learners and working with culturally socially and economically diverse families.Strong collaboration skills required with the ability to lead teams of teachers staff members and other stakeholders.Proven ability to workeffectivelywith building and district administrators.Demonstrated skill facilitating collaborative Professional Learning Community teams.Demonstrated effective development and presentation of training modules.Ability to be highly organized and maintain records and documents to ensure compliance as defined by OSPI and the WA StateMultilingual Education Program.Ability to work alongside leadership and clearly communicate program progress needs successes and deficiencies.

BENEFITS: Health insurance benefits for employees working 630 hours or more per year include medical dental vision life and long term disability plans through the School Employees Benefits Board (SEBB). Retirement benefits are provided through the WA State Department of Retirement Systems (DRS). growth reimbursement $1000/year for qualified expenses.

Paid leave benefits include 12 days of sick leave and 3 personal leave days.

may be prorated based upon date of hire/FTE.
